What percent of Earth s total volume is the crust? Select one of the options below as your answer:a. 0.5%
b. 1%
c. 5%
d. 10%

Answers

Answer 1
Answer: The Earth's Crust contributes only about 1% to its volume - the correct answer is b). (it's no wonder since in some places it's only 3 miles thick!)

The biggest portion of the Earth's volume is taken up by the Mantle - around 84%. 15% of the Earth's volume are found in the innermost layer, the core.

Which are closer to the equator the nomads of the sahara or coffee growers of colombia

Answers

Answer:

The correct answer is coffee growers in Colombia

Explanation:

Besides having close latitudes, the Colombian territory is crossed by the Equator Line in its southern portion. And in this part of that country is localized most of coffee production, although it’s cultivated in 19 of its administrative regions.  

Coffee farmers have chosen the Mountain Rage Region to produce their crops. As the final part of the Andes Mountain Rage (one of the highest and largest in the world), the Colombian Mountains have the perfect climate to produce coffee. These seeds don’t stand high temperatures, but because of the mountains high (up to 6,000 feet, or 2,000 meters), the weather tends to be constant the whole year. Temperatures don’t rise too much, and get a bit cooler in the night. And also there’s abundant rain the whole year.  

For example, if you go to Bogota, the capital situated next to the geographical center of Colombia, you will face 65 Fahrenheit (19 Celsus) in the day-time, and around 46 Fahrenheit (8 Celsus) in the night, with a rain shower at the beginning of the evening. That forecast is almost the same the whole year. But if you're on the coast at the same latitude in Colombia, you’ll have around 86 Fahrenheit (30 Celsus) and warm nights.  

The Colombian Coffee is awarded as the best one in the world for many years. It’s qualify because of its flavor, smell, and visual aspects.
